Programmable Fluid Controllers
Programmable fluid controllers are key to controlling the quantity and timing of fluid dispensed in your operation. Depending on your needs, they can do much more. In addition to advanced output control, fluid controllers can monitor critical inputs and trigger emergency shutdowns, integrate controls with press PLC, and store job settings for easy changeovers.

Supplemental & In-Die Spray
Spray nozzles are a great solution for lubricating uneven parts or adding supplemental spray. Our products offer a number of spray types, patterns and adjustment options.
